Design and Ergonomics
The EOS R50 is engineered for portability and intuitive operation. Weighing approximately 375 grams (body only), it is one of the lightest APS-C mirrorless cameras in Canon’s RF lineup. This compactness directly informs its primary use case: mobile, everyday photography.
The camera’s simplified control layout reduces cognitive load for beginners while retaining essential manual overrides. A vari-angle touchscreen facilitates unconventional shooting angles and supports solo content creation. From a usability standpoint, this positions the R50 as a bridge device—less intimidating than professional bodies, yet more capable than smartphones.
However, the absence of in-body image stabilization (IBIS) introduces constraints in handheld low-light scenarios. Users must rely on lens-based stabilization or digital correction, which may influence lens selection and shooting technique.
Autofocus and Subject Detection
A defining feature of the EOS R50 is its implementation of Dual Pixel CMOS AF II, inherited from higher-end Canon models. This system employs deep-learning algorithms to detect and track subjects including humans, animals, and vehicles.
In practical terms, this translates to high reliability in dynamic environments such as street photography, wildlife observation, and casual sports shooting. Eye detection autofocus, in particular, enhances portrait workflows by maintaining critical focus even with shallow depth of field.
The autofocus system significantly reduces the technical barrier for novice photographers. Instead of mastering complex focus modes, users can rely on subject detection to achieve consistent results. This aligns with the broader trend of computational assistance in imaging, where automation augments rather than replaces user intent.
Image Quality and Sensor Performance
The EOS R50 features a 24.2-megapixel APS-C CMOS sensor paired with Canon’s DIGIC X processor. This combination delivers strong image quality within its class, particularly in well-lit conditions.
Dynamic range is adequate for everyday photography, though it does not match full-frame sensors in high-contrast scenes. Noise performance remains controlled up to moderate ISO levels, making the camera suitable for indoor and low-light shooting with appropriate exposure management.
Color science remains a hallmark of Canon cameras, with accurate skin tones and pleasing color rendition. This is particularly relevant for portrait and lifestyle photography, where minimal post-processing is often preferred.
Video Capabilities and Content Creation
The EOS R50 is explicitly designed with content creators in mind. It supports uncropped 4K video at up to 30 frames per second, oversampled from 6K, resulting in detailed footage. Full HD recording extends to 120 fps, enabling slow-motion applications.
A key innovation is Canon’s “Advanced A+ Assist” and “Creative Assist” modes, which simplify exposure and stylistic adjustments. These features cater to users who prioritize output over technical configuration.
The camera also includes a dedicated vertical video mode, reflecting the dominance of platforms such as TikTok and Instagram Reels. This orientation-aware recording streamlines content production workflows by eliminating the need for post-capture cropping.
Despite these strengths, the lack of headphone monitoring and limited heat management in extended recording sessions may constrain professional video use. The R50 is therefore best suited for short-form content rather than long-form production.
Connectivity and Workflow Integration
Modern imaging devices must integrate seamlessly into digital ecosystems. The EOS R50 addresses this through built-in Wi-Fi and Bluetooth connectivity, enabling rapid file transfer to smartphones via the Canon Camera Connect app.
This capability is central to its use case as a content creation tool. Users can capture, edit, and publish images or videos within minutes, aligning with the immediacy of social media platforms.
Additionally, the camera functions as a plug-and-play webcam via USB, expanding its utility for remote work, streaming, and online education. This multifunctionality enhances its value proposition, particularly for users seeking a single device for multiple roles.
Lens Ecosystem and System Considerations
The EOS R50 uses Canon’s RF mount, granting access to both RF and RF-S lenses. While the RF ecosystem continues to expand, entry-level users may encounter cost barriers compared to legacy EF lenses.
Adapters mitigate this issue by enabling compatibility with older EF and EF-S lenses, though this may compromise the compact form factor. Native RF-S lenses, such as the RF-S 18–45mm kit lens, prioritize portability but may limit creative flexibility due to modest apertures.
From a system perspective, the R50 serves as an entry point into Canon’s mirrorless lineup. Users can gradually expand their lens collection and transition to higher-end bodies without abandoning their investment.

Despite its strengths, the EOS R50 is not without constraints:
- Lack of IBIS limits handheld stability in challenging conditions
- Limited buffer depth affects continuous shooting performance
- Entry-level build quality may not withstand demanding environments
- Restricted video features compared to higher-end models
These limitations reinforce its positioning as an entry-level hybrid camera rather than a professional tool.
